From the May 12, 1982 Shawano Evening Leader:
    Eva M. Anderson, Rt. 2, Shawano, Town of Richmond, 90, died on Monday, May 10 in Shawano.
    She was the former Eva M. Gilkey, the daughter of the late Mr. and Mrs. Everett Gilkey, born on Dec. 21, 1891 in Oconto County. She was an established pianist, music teacher, and a graduate of the New York Conservatory of Music. Many years ago, she had played for the silent movies in Shawano. She was married on May 16, 1914 in Shawano to James M. Anderson, who passed away on June 8, 1971. She was a member of the United Presbyterian Church, Shawano. She served as church organist for many years and music director of the church Sunday school for many years.
    Survivors include one daughter, Lucile A. Anderson of Cicero, Ill.; one son, James E. Anderson of Shawano; three grandchildren; three great-grandchildren; two sisters, Mrs. Henrietta Gilkey of Shawano and Lucille Fitzgerald of Winter Park, Florida. One sister and one brother preceded her in death.
Memorial services will be held on Friday at 1 p.m. at the First United Presbyterian Church, Shawano, with Rev. Ed Esier and Rev. Lynn Kollath officiating. Burial will be in the Hickory Cemetery, Hickory, Oconto County.
